Karate:Foot and leg sweeps

 In our Online Karate course at Zelus Academy, you'll explore the art of foot and leg sweeps, an effective technique for knocking an opponent off balance and gaining the upper hand in a match. Sweeps are a fundamental part of Karate, utilizing either a kick or a grappling motion to target one or both of your opponent’s legs, causing them to lose stability and fall.

Our Karate online learning platform will guide you through four essential types of sweeps, each with its unique application in combat. You’ll start with the Back Leg Sweep, which is designed to strike your opponent’s rear leg, effectively destabilizing them from behind. This technique is particularly useful when you need to create distance or counter an incoming attack.

Next, you’ll learn the Front Leg Scissor Sweep, a dynamic move that involves using your legs in a scissor-like motion to sweep both of your opponent’s legs out from under them. This technique combines power and precision, making it a potent tool in your Karate arsenal.

The course also covers the Reverse Sweep, which focuses on a swift, backward motion to target and sweep your opponent’s leg, catching them off guard. Finally, you’ll practice the Circle Sweep, a versatile move that uses a circular motion to sweep your opponent’s legs, perfect for creating openings in their defense.
